Law No 2019/024 of 24 december 2019 bill to institute the general code of regional and local authorities › Book 0 › Title 3 › Chapter 2

SECTION 220

(1) The mayor shall exercise road traffic policing powers within the jurisdiction of his council. (2) He may, against payment of levies fixed by the council, grant parking permits or authorizations for the temporary use of public roads, rivers, river ports, quays and other public places under the jurisdiction of the council, on condition that such usage does not hinder traffic on the public road or waterway. (3) The mayor shall grant temporary and revocable permits for the use of public roads, in accordance with the laws and regulations in force. Such permits shall notably be intended for the installation of water supply, electricity or telephone networks on the ground and on public roads.
